Why founders over 50 should review family health governance

As business and wealth decisions intensify, cardiovascular, metabolic, cancer screening, and energy planning need a clearer rhythm. Family health governance turns reactive decisions into a system, especially for multi-generation and cross-border families. For high-net-worth families, the value is turning scattered tests, physician comments, and lifestyle work into a reviewable decision system.
